Cost of a transponder Key The majority of newer vehicles come with transponder keys that can prevent theft and increase security of vehicles. The keys are equipped with a tiny microchip that sends a unique code to the immobilizer system of the car when inserted into the ignition. The computer system in the car validates this code to make sure that it can only be started with the right key. The most typical indication of a transponder key that is malfunctioning is difficulty starting the vehicle. The engine will spin but will not start. This can be a sign that the chip isn't communicating with the immobilizer. This is typically due to a programming mistake or physical damage to the key. A defective transponder could compromise the security of your vehicle by disarming the immobilizer system. This leaves your vehicle vulnerable to theft or unauthorized access.
